What Is a Collimating Lens? – Understanding the Core of Modern Optical Systems


A collimating lens is an optical lens designed to transform divergent light—typically from a laser diode, LED, or fiber—into a parallel (collimated) beam. 

By reducing divergence, the lens ensures the beam maintains consistent direction, intensity, and quality over long distances. 

This makes collimating lenses indispensable in applications such as laser modules, medical devices, barcode scanners, measurement systems, and machine vision.

Collimating lenses are engineered in various shapes—including aspheric, plano-convex, and molded glass designs—to optimize beam uniformity and minimize optical aberrations. 

High-precision versions can achieve extremely low divergence angles, making them suitable for demanding scientific and industrial environments.
